Designing Trade Agreement Utilization Team Structure in Electronics Companies for Automation
A typical finance team in electronics manufacturing balancing trade agreements includes analysts, compliance specialists, and IT liaisons. Automation succeeds when this structure supports clear data ownership and integration points, such as:
- Analysts monitoring supplier data and tariff codes
- Compliance specialists validating rules of origin
- IT liaisons managing ERP and trade management system integrations
For example, a mid-tier circuit board manufacturer cut manual tariff classifications by 60% after aligning analysts directly with automated rule engines and integrating supplier data feeds into the ERP. This structure avoids common bottlenecks where compliance specialists are overwhelmed with spreadsheets.
1. Standardize Data Inputs Across Suppliers
In electronics manufacturing, supplier data variability is a major hurdle. Automating trade agreement workflows demands consistent data formats for HS codes, origin certificates, and shipment details. One firm mandated CSV templates prebuilt with validation rules to reduce errors by 35%.
A standardized input eliminates 20-30% of manual rework common in finance teams processing variable data formats. This step also simplifies integration with trade compliance software.
2. Use Rule-Based Automation Engines for Tariff Classification
Rather than relying on manual tariff lookups, companies automate classification through configurable rule engines. These engines apply preferential trade rules based on product attributes and regional criteria.
An electronics components manufacturer reported a 40% reduction in classification errors by deploying a rule engine integrated with their ERP. This automation sped up processing time from days to hours per shipment.
3. Integrate ERP and Trade Compliance Platforms
Manual data transfer between ERP, customs systems, and trade agreement platforms wastes time and risks errors. Finance teams should leverage API integrations or middleware to automate data exchange.
One large electronics OEM integrated their SAP system with a trade compliance tool, enabling automatic validation of trade agreement eligibility during invoice processing. This eliminated duplicated entry and increased utilization rates by 12%.
4. Automate Rules of Origin Verification
Rules of origin require detailed product component tracking, often the trickiest part for mid-level teams. Workflow automation that cross-references BOM data with supplier certificates reduces manual checks drastically.
A manufacturer in semiconductor assembly integrated their BOM system with rules-of-origin validation software, reducing manual verification from hours per invoice to minutes. This automation captures cost savings faster and supports audit trails.
5. Establish Workflow Alerts and Exception Handling
Automated workflows must include alerts for exceptions, such as missing certificates or conflicting tariff codes. Without this, teams risk unnoticed errors leading to denied preferential treatment.
A finance team at an electronics device maker built rule-based alerts that flagged 98% of discrepancies within 24 hours, improving responsiveness and compliance.
6. Implement Role-Based Access Controls
To maintain integrity, automation platforms should restrict actions by user role—finance analysts can view data and run reports, while compliance specialists approve utilization requests.
This separation reduces risk of errors and encourages accountability. One company saw a 25% reduction in erroneous tariff claims after deploying role-based permissions.
7. Use Data Analytics to Identify Underutilized Agreements
Automation should feed utilization data into analytics dashboards that identify missed trade agreement opportunities. For example, a manufacturer discovered they were missing savings on a lesser-known Asia-Pacific agreement, leading to a 3% boost in cost reduction.
Integrating analytics with workflow automation turns raw data into actionable insights for continuous improvement.
8. Schedule Periodic Automated Compliance Audits
Automated audit scripts can scan transaction data regularly to verify compliance with trade agreement rules and flag anomalies. This proactive approach prevents large penalties and compliance drift.
Several electronics companies reported saving thousands in fines and penalties by catching errors early with automated audits.
9. Train Teams on Automation Tools and Processes
Even the best automation fails without competent users. Mid-level professionals should receive targeted training emphasizing how automation integrates into their workflows and how to interpret system alerts.
User adoption increases by 40% when training includes hands-on simulations and ongoing support.
10. Coordinate with Supply Chain and Procurement Teams
Trade agreement utilization depends on upstream data quality. Finance should collaborate closely with procurement to ensure supplier declarations and certificates meet automation system requirements.
A consumer electronics firm reduced document processing lead time by 50% after launching a cross-department initiative to standardize supplier compliance data.

12. Measure Trade Agreement Utilization ROI to Justify Automation Investments
Calculating ROI involves comparing incremental tariff savings against automation costs—software licenses, integration, and training. One electronics manufacturer reported a 5x return within the first year by automating utilization workflows, driven mainly by faster processing and reduced errors.
Metrics to track include time saved, error reduction rate, increased utilization percentage, and compliance penalties avoided.
Common Trade Agreement Utilization Mistakes in Electronics?
- Overreliance on Manual Data Entry: Many teams still struggle with spreadsheet-heavy processes, causing errors and slowdowns.
- Poor Data Standardization: Inconsistent supplier data leads to rework and incomplete tariff claims.
- Lack of Integration: Disconnected ERP, procurement, and compliance systems waste valuable cycle time.
- Ignoring Exception Management: Without automated alerts, mistakes often go unnoticed until audits.
- Insufficient Training: Automation tools fall flat without user understanding and engagement.
Avoiding these mistakes accelerates benefits and reduces costly compliance risks.

Trade Agreement Utilization ROI Measurement in Manufacturing?
Measure ROI by calculating:
| Metric | Description | Calculation Example |
|---|---|---|
| Time saved | Hours reduced in manual processing | 200 hours/month × $50/hour = $10,000/month |
| Error reduction rate | Percentage decrease in incorrect claims | 40% reduction saves $15,000 in penalties annually |
| Increase in utilization | Additional preferential tariff captured | 5% increase on $10M imports = $500,000 savings |
| Compliance penalties avoided | Fines prevented through better controls | $100,000 penalty avoided annually |
Total ROI = (Savings + penalties avoided) – Automation costs
Tracking these numbers justifies continued investment and process refinement.
